Mascareñaz to Join the Colorado Education Initiative Team

The Colorado Education Initiative (CEI) announced today that Landon Mascareñaz will join as its Vice President of Community Partnership. Mascareñaz will lead CEI’s community engagement, family partnership, equity, and policy initiatives. “CEI is building a movement across the state to reinvest in public education while also demanding something radically new …
